Syllabus

Course Objectives

The course aims to provide the basic elements to analyze and identify the geotechnical risk associated with the construction of excavations, the triggering of landslides, the occurrence of critical conditions in the ground following seismic events and introduces the choice of the engineering works to enhance the safety within the current regulatory framework.


Course Prerequisites

Basic knowledge of soil mechanics is required


Teaching Methods

The course is divided into: a) lessons on all the topics of the course with an active interaction with the students; b) exercises. During the exercises, students will be guided to solve application examples through the use of analytical methods and/or numerical-analysis software.

Contents

1. BRIEF OVERVIEW OF THE MECHANICAL PROPERTIES DETERMINATION OF SOILS FOR STABILITY PROBLEMS FROM IN-SITU AND LABORATORY TESTS. 2. EXCAVATIONS. Excavations for foundation works and trench excavations. Unprotected and protected excavations. A brief outline on the failure phenomena of the excavations. Excavations under the water table and dewatering systems. 3. RISK OF LANDSLIDES IN NATURAL AND ARTIFICIAL SLOPES (dams, embankments, etc). A brief outline on the classification of landslides. Safety levels and critical slip surface. Operational tools for slope safety analysis: use of calculation codes. Effects of water seepage on slope stability. Slope stability control and monitoring tools. A brief outline on the types of slope stabilization methods. 4. RISK OF SOILS LIQUEFACTION DUE TO SEISMIC EVENT. Origin of earthquakes and geotechnical risk phenomena associated with seismic events. Categories of the subsoil for seismic purposes. Stability of a site against the liquefaction of soils. 5 INTRODUCTION TO NATIONAL BUILDING CODE
